What affects the price

When you call for a chimney repair estimate, a few main things influence the final bill. The height of your home and how easily technicians can reach the chimney stack often dictate labor costs. The specific materials needed—whether you are dealing with standard brick, custom stone, or specialized flue liners—also play a part. Repairs involving structural masonry work or internal firebox reconstruction require more time than simple cap replacements or mortar joint touch-ups. Is chimney repair covered under homeowners insurance in Albuquerque?

Homeowners insurance in Albuquerque may cover chimney damage if it resulted from a covered peril, such as a fire or a severe storm. Routine wear and tear or lack of maintenance typically won't be covered. It's always a good idea to check your policy details or speak with your insurance provider after getting a repair quote.

What is the 3 to 10 rule for chimneys?

The '3 to 10 rule' is a guideline for chimney height. It generally states that the chimney should extend at least three feet above the roofline where it passes through, and be at least two feet taller than any object within a ten-foot radius. This ensures proper ventilation and smoke dispersal.
